The Most Important Technique in Gambling
While many casino players focus on game strategies and finding "hot" machines, the single most important skill for long-term enjoyment and success in gambling is effective bankroll management. It's not about guaranteeing wins—that's impossible. This discipline is the practice of managing the money you have set aside for casino gambling in a way that increases your playing time and minimizes the risk of losing it all too quickly. It's about staying in control, making smart financial decisions, and ensuring that your casino entertainment remains sustainable and fu

Once you have your session bankroll, you need to determine your standard bet size. Wagering too large a percentage of your bankroll on a single hand or spin (e.g., 20%) is a recipe for going broke quickl A good rule of thumb is to make your average bet size around 1-2% of your session bankroll. This strategy allows you to withstand the natural swings of variance in casino games. If you're playing slots, this means choosing a machine and bet level where your spin cost is in this range.

Unlike a regular jackpot slot, where the top prize is a fixed amount (e.g., 10,000x your stake), a progressive jackpot accumulates over time. Here's the basic mechanic: casino - https://justcars.ng/author/mablehoff57088, each time a player makes a wager on a progressive jackpot game, a small percentage of that bet is contributed to the jackpot pool. How Progressive Jackpots Work? This jackpot continues to grow with every wager made by every player on the network, until one fortunate player hits the winning combination and takes home the entire amount. Once the jackpot is won, it returns to a predetermined "seed" amount (which can still be a substantial sum) and the process begins all over agai
